Welcome to Measuremint!

Glad you're building plugins for our recipe-scaling calculator. Scaling hooks fire after unit normalization, so work in grams. Sandbox keys reset weekly — no big deal. To unlock the plugin signing sandbox for the first time, the CLI will ask for the shared recovery passphrase, which you'll find directly below.

unlock words, hahip-baduf: holwyn-istath-julvan

**Action Item 7 (owner: on-call rotation):** During the Velloway outage, config hot-reload raced with the watcher restart, leaving stale pool sizes in memory for forty minutes. Verify the reload debounce and watcher retry settings on every deploy before acknowledging the pager. The constants to confirm are listed below.

tuning table, kajog-kawef:
PRIORITIES = {
    "kelox": 870,
    "kasix": 89,
    "eliax": 988,
}

## Runbook: Pool Resize on Release

Before cutover, drain the Gristmill connection pool: set `pool.max` to 0, wait for active connections to hit zero, then restore to 40. Verify replica lag under 2s. Do not skip the drain — stale connections pin the old schema. Deploy proceeds only after pool health check passes. Authenticate the deploy with the key below.

release key, fahaf-bajof: bky3_Xam